Post
Create a new subscription
Parameters:
Name
Optional / Required
Data type
Description
Default
itc_product_id
required
String
min. 5 characters, max. 255 characters
name
required
String
min. 5 characters, max. 50 characters
duration
required
Integer
7, 31, 62, 93, 186 or 365 (days)
description
optional
String
min. 5 characters, max. 255 characters
kiosks
optional
String
One or multiple kiosk ids (webkiosk_123 or webkiosk_123,appkiosk_456), values must start with webkiosk_ or appkiosk_
Demo
URL Find your token on - yumpu.com Token
itc_product_id name duration
Optional parameters:
description kiosks
Add optional parametersRun request
Example:
curl -X POST -H "X-ACCESS-TOKEN: YOUR_ACCESS_TOKEN" -d "itc_product_id=subscription6" -d "name=subscription6" -d "description=subscription6" -d "duration=62" -d "kiosks=webkiosk_25" "https://api.yumpu.com/2.0/account/subscription.json"Example:
require_once('../yumpu.php');
$yumpu = new Yumpu();
$data = array(
'itc_product_id' => 'subscription6',
'name' => 'my subscription6 name',
'duration' => 62,
'description' => 'my subscription6 description',
'kiosks' => 'webkiosk_25'
);
$postSubscription = $yumpu->postSubscription($data);
print_r($postSubscription);Example:
var yumpu = require('yumpu');
yumpu.setToken('yourToken');
var parameters = {
itc_product_id: 'subscription6',
name: 'subscription6',
description: 'subscription6'.
duration: 62,
kiosks: 'webkiosk_25'
};
yumpu.postSubscription(parameters, function(statusCode, document){
console.log('Status: ' + statusCode);
console.log(document);
});Example:
Whatever language you are using, the result will be the same.
Last updated
Was this helpful?